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black scale | Indonesian Mountain Weasel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Hemiptera (Hemiptera) | Carnivora (Carnivorans) |
| Family | Coccidae |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ters) |
| Genus | Saissetia | Mustela |
| Species | Saissetia oleae | Mustela lutreolina |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black scale and Indonesian Mountain Weasel share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
